Abstract

The development of higher education, especially Islamic Religious Universities (PTKI), focuses on innovation in teaching, learning, and the ethics of lecturers as role models. PTKI plays an important role in shaping an excellent generation through the integration of knowledge and Islamic values. This study aims to explore the contribution of academic competence enhancement programs and Islamic educators' ethics development to the professional development of PTKI lecturers, as well as their impact on academic work engagement. The research uses an exploratory quantitative approach with a cross-sectional design to examine PTKI lecturers' professional development. Data were collected through open-ended questionnaire surveys of 150 respondents selected via purposive sampling. Data analysis was conducted using the PLS-SEM technique to evaluate the validity of the structural model and the relationships between latent variables and their indicators. The findings show that academic competence enhancement programs and Islamic educators' ethics development have a significant positive impact on lecturers' professional development. Professional development directly influences and mediates academic work engagement. Lecturers who continuously develop their competence and ethics tend to be more engaged in academic tasks, highly committed, and capable of creating dynamic and collaborative learning environments. This study encourages PTKI to design ongoing training programs tailored to lecturers' needs and promote inter-campus synergy through research collaboration.

Abstract

Corruption and money laundering are global issues with significant economic impacts, particularly in Asia and Europe. This comparative study explores the relationship between national culture, public governance, and money laundering potential, focusing on cultural differences between the East and West. Utilizing a quantitative approach, the study analyzes secondary data from the 2023 Basel Anti-Money Laundering (AML) Index, covering 49 Asian and 47 European countries. Structural Equation Modelling-Partial Least Square (SEM-PLS) is employed for analysis. The findings reveal that cultural dynamics significantly and positively influence public governance. However, public governance and cultural dynamics do not directly affect the potential for money laundering. Mediation tests indicate that public governance mediates the relationship between cultural dynamics and money laundering potential. A Multigroup Analysis (MGA) test highlights significant regional differences, particularly in the influence of public governance on money laundering potential. The study underscores the need for multifaceted strategies to combat money laundering globally, emphasizing international collaboration, public education, governance enhancement, and technological advancement. Recommendations for the Financial Action Task Force (FATF) include strengthening cross-country cooperation and improving public governance frameworks to mitigate global money laundering risks effectively.

Abstract

Problematika global seperti kemiskinan, ketimpangan, dan perubahan iklim mendorong PBB menetapkan SDGs untuk menciptakan dunia berkelanjutan. Meski Indonesia mengalami pertumbuhan ekonomi yang signifikan, distribusinya masih belum merata. Desentralisasi fiskal menjadi strategi penting untuk memastikan pembangunan inklusif di seluruh wilayah. Studi ini menganalisis pengaruh desentralisasi fiskal terhadap ekonomi digital dan dampaknya pada keberlanjutan serta pencapaian SDGs lokal di tingkat Provinsi di Indonesia. Penelitian ini menggunakan pendekatan kuantitatif eksploratif untuk mengeksplorasi hubungan antara desentralisasi fiskal, ekonomi digital, dan kinerja keberlanjutan di 34 provinsi Indonesia pada 2023. Data sekunder diolah menggunakan PLS-SEM untuk memprediksi hubungan antarvariabel. Penelitian ini menemukan bahwa desentralisasi fiskal tidak memiliki dampak signifikan terhadap ekonomi digital dan keberlanjutan di tingkat makro, bertentangan dengan literatur yang ada. Ekonomi digital terbukti berperan penting dalam pencapaian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) di tingkat lokal. Desentralisasi fiskal juga mendukung keberlanjutan sosial melalui pengelolaan sumber daya lokal yang lebih baik. Ekonomi digital berfungsi sebagai mediator, memperkuat hubungan antara desentralisasi fiskal dan keberlanjutan. Penelitian ini menekankan pentingnya integrasi desentralisasi fiskal dengan teknologi digital untuk meningkatkan efektivitas kebijakan, mengoptimalkan alokasi dana, dan mendorong partisipasi masyarakat dalam mencapai SDGs.

Abstract

Global warming and climate change demand sustainable responses from the business sector, including SMEs, which are now the largest contributors to emissions. SMEs in Indonesia, especially in the DI Yogyakarta Province, have the potential to become key players in world-class green trade. This study aims to investigate the influence of transportation infrastructure, logistics capabilities, and Green Information System on the capabilities of SMEs in the DI Yogyakarta Province in world-class green trade. The study adopts a quantitative approach based on a survey of 225 SME owners in the DI Yogyakarta Province. Purposive sampling technique was selected and analyzed using Partial Least Square-Structural Equation Modelling (PLS-SEM). The results show that transportation infrastructure substantially influences the ability of SMEs' green supply chains and global logistics. The logistics capabilities of SMEs in Yogyakarta have a positive impact on the capabilities of green supply chains. The implementation of GIS has also been shown to enhance the capabilities of green supply chains and international logistics by providing visibility, transparency, and efficiency in business operations. The influence of supply chain capabilities was found to be significantly positive on international logistics. The research findings affirm the crucial role of green supply chain capabilities and international logistics in enhancing the capabilities of SMEs to enter international trade.

Abstract

The healthcare sector in Indonesia faces challenges in managing capital efficiency and organizational performance due to high operational costs and the need for continuous investment in health technology and infrastructure. As a key driver of economic growth, especially post-COVID-19, optimal capital management is crucial for sustaining operations and creating stakeholder value. This study examines the relationship between the Weighted Average Cost of Capital (WACC) and Return on Assets (ROA) in Indonesia’s healthcare sector using a quantitative dynamic panel analysis approach. Financial data from healthcare companies listed on the Indonesia Stock Exchange were analyzed using the Generalized Method of Moments (GMM). The findings indicate that WACC negatively affects ROA, but the relationship is not statistically significant. Leverage, measured through the Debt to Asset Ratio and Debt to Equity Ratio, strengthens this relationship positively. Meanwhile, cash holdings and firm size have a negative moderating effect, whereas Net Working Capital (NWC) reinforces the relationship positively. These results highlight the importance of effective debt and liquidity management in optimizing profitability in the healthcare sector. The study contributes theoretically to capital efficiency discussions and offers practical insights for industry stakeholders, including decision-makers and investors. The research is novel in its focus on Indonesia’s healthcare sector, making it highly relevant for financial and strategic planning in the industry.

Abstract

Amid growing global pressure for sustainability, the banking sector faces increasing demands to adopt environmentally friendly practices through the concept of green banking. This study addresses a gap in the literature by specifically analyzing how internal capabilities and state financial policies drive the adoption of green banking practices in state-owned banks in Indonesia. By integrating the Diffusion of Innovation (DOI) and Resource-Based View (RBV) frameworks, the study offers a novel perspective on sustainability adoption in the banking sector of a developing country. Data were collected through a Likert-scale survey of 274 employees from Indonesian state-owned banks and analyzed using Partial Least Squares–Structural Equation Modelling (PLS-SEM). The findings reveal that relative advantage, compatibility, and organizational support are key internal factors driving green banking adoption. Externally, human resource quality, regulatory pressure, sustainable financial policies, and global business dynamics further enhance the adoption process. The results also show that green banking implementation significantly improves Triple Bottom Line (TBL) performance, including operational efficiency and environmental risk reduction. This study highlights the importance of synergy between strengthening internal bank capacities and fiscal policy support—such as tax incentives from the Ministry of Finance—in fostering a sustainable financial ecosystem in Indonesia.

Abstract

Desa Raba, Kecamatan Wawo, Kabupaten Bima, Provinsi Nusa Tenggara Barat, memiliki sektor pertanian sebagai salah satu mata pencaharian utama masyarakatnya, terutama dalam budidaya kacang tanah. Namun, tingginya jumlah hama tikus di wilayah ini sering kali menyebabkan kerusakan tanaman yang cukup serius, sehingga berdampak pada menurunnya hasil panen dan bahkan berpotensi mengakibatkan gagal panen. Kendala utama yang dihadapi petani dalam menangani hama ini adalah keterbatasan waktu serta jarak antara tempat tinggal dan lahan pertanian mereka, Penelitian ini bertujuan untuk mengembangkan alat pengusir hama tikus berbasis Internet of Things yang dilengkapi dengan PIR Motion Sensor dan aplikasi Blynk, sehingga pengendalian hama dapat dilakukan secara otomatis dan dari jarak jauh. Sistem yang dirancang menggunakan sensor gerak PIR untuk mendeteksi keberadaan tikus, yang kemudian akan mengaktifkan alarm suara dan lampu sebagai respons untuk mengusir hama tersebut. Selain itu, petani dapat memantau serta mengendalikan perangkat ini melalui aplikasi Blynk yang terhubung ke jaringan internet, sehingga memungkinkan pengoperasian alat tanpa harus berada langsung di lahan pertanian. Metode yang digunakan dalam pengembangan sistem ini adalah model prototyping, dengan dilengkapi diagram sistem guna memastikan seluruh komponen dapat bekerja secara optimal. Proses pengujian dilakukan menggunakan metode black-box, yang menunjukkan bahwa alat dapat berfungsi sesuai dengan rancangan awal, seperti mendeteksi keberadaan tikus, mengaktifkan sistem pengusiran, serta mengirimkan notifikasi ke aplikasi Blynk secara real-time. Dengan adanya inovasi ini, diharapkan petani, khususnya di Desa Raba, dapat lebih mudah dalam menangani hama tikus secara efektif, meningkatkan hasil pertanian kacang tanah, serta mengurangi potensi kerugian akibat serangan hama.
